How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Orlando?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Orlando Studio Apartments | $1,528 | $840 | $2,635 |
| Orlando 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,719 | $250 | $3,852 |
| Orlando 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,056 | $641 | $4,468 |
| Orlando 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,496 | $748 | $9,000 |
| Orlando 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,072 | $695 | $7,880 |
| Orlando 5 Bedroom Apartments | $1,616 | $899 | $3,850 |
